* cygheap.cc (cwcsdup): New function.
(cwcsdup1): New function.
* cygheap.h (cygheap_user::get_windows_id): New method returning PWCHAR.
(cwcsdup): Declare.
(cwcsdup1): Declare.
* registry.cc (get_registry_hive_path): Use WCHAR instead of char
throughout.
(load_registry_hive): Ditto.
* registry.h (get_registry_hive_path): Change declaration accordingly.
(load_registry_hive): Ditto.
* sec_helper.cc (cygpsid::string): New method returning PWCHAR.
* security.h (cygpsid::string): Declare.
* syscalls.cc (seteuid32): Convert local name var to WCHAR.
* uinfo.cc (cygheap_user::env_userprofile): Convert local name buffers
to WCHAR. Call sys_wcstombs_alloc to generate puserprof buffer.
* winsup.h: Fix comment.
(NT_MAX_PATH): New definition for maximum internal path length.
Use throughout where appropriate.
* include/limits.h (PATH_MAX): Set to 4096 as on Linux.
